BL!NKr: A DIY Self-Contained LED Strip Control Unit

A project in Sacramento, CA by Tom Berarducci - TNB Technologies, LLC

Build your own LED strip controller that's both versatile and simple, with support for many LED strip types and NO APP NEEDED!
